The graph \(\Gamma\) is said to be \(s\)-geodesic transitive, if \(\Gamma\) contains an \(s\)-geodesic and its automorphism group is transitive on the set of \(t\)-geodesics for all \(t\leq s\). The authors give a classification of the family of \(2\)-geodesic transitive graphs having valency \(9\). The authors also completely determined those graphs which are geodesic transitive.
